About Hung-I Lin

Hung-I Lin is a scholar working on Environmental Engineering, Geochemistry and Petrology and Water Science and Technology, having authored 8 papers that have together received 579 indexed citations. Recurring topics across this work include Groundwater flow and contamination studies (4 papers), Groundwater and Watershed Analysis (3 papers), Hydrology and Watershed Management Studies (2 papers), Groundwater and Isotope Geochemistry (2 papers), Rock Mechanics and Modeling (2 papers), Flood Risk Assessment and Management (2 papers), Hydraulic Fracturing and Reservoir Analysis (2 papers) and Seismic Waves and Analysis (1 paper). The work is most often cited by research in Environmental Engineering (450 citations), Geochemistry and Petrology (139 citations) and Water Science and Technology (217 citations). Hung-I Lin has collaborated with scholars based in Taiwan. Frequent co-authors include Cheng-Haw Lee, Hsin‐Fu Yeh, Youg-Sin Cheng and Kuo‐Chin Hsu. Their work appears in journals such as Environmental Earth Sciences, Tunnelling and Underground Space Technology, Water, Engineering Geology and Journal of Earth System Science.
